After the villains arrive at the satellite headquarters of the Injustice Gang, Luthor uses the stolen S.T.A.R. Labs device to control the just-launched Comlab One. Spider-Man and Superman tackle their foes in orbit before the Metropolis Marvel must return Earthside to confront a tsunami, while Doctor Octopus is stunned by the extent of his partner's schemes.
